Arman Mastan
Najeeb Khan
Iskandar Abd Razak
Dr Rina Maguire
Producer
Rayner Goh
Assistant Director
Effie Poh
Sound Recordist
Zandy Lim Xin Hui
Camera Operator
Siti Nurnabilah Bte Surhadi
Eileen Sim
Director of Photography
Karl Francis Gonzales
Director
Izelle Tan
Assistant Camera
Jie Tong Chiang
Editor
Rachel Lai